P933 KHN is a 1998 Toyota Surf in Black with a 3,000c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 29 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 58.6%.
Across all 1998 Toyota Surf models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.0% with a typical mileage of 144,866 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Toyota Surf fails its MOT is fog lamp not working, accounting for 1,393 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P933 KHN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Toyota Surf typically stays on UK roads for around 35 years. At 28 years old, this Toyota Surf is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
